How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Fairfax?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Fairfax Studio Apartments | $1,395 | $825 | $1,660 |
Fairfax 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,601 | $835 | $2,065 |
Fairfax 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,128 | $925 | $3,460 |
Fairfax 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,762 | $1,425 | $4,050 |
Fairfax 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,585 | $4,585 | $4,585 |

Getting Around the Fairfax Neighborhood in Cincinnati, OH
Walk Score®
53 / 100
Somewhat Walkable
Some errands can be accomplished on foot
Bike Score®
44 / 100
Somewhat Bikeable
Minimal bike infrastructure
Transit Score®
1 / 100
Minimal Transit
It may be possible to get on a bus
